Sailing on the Finest Eastern Caribbean Cruises

The Eastern Caribbean Cruise is one of the most sought-after cruises in the Caribbean islands. This cruise spends more time on land than on the sea since the ports of call are not too distant from each other. On the Easter Caribbean cruise, one can enjoy and relax in the tropical islands white powdery sand and the clear turquoise waters or take part in water or beach activities such as snorkeling, beach volleyball, scuba diving, and parasailing. Cruises to the Eastern region varies from a few days like weekends up to a week long or more. Cruise ship prices differ depending on the company, accommodation types and services included from the cheapest to the most luxurious type. These cruises almost always include ports of call at Bahamas, Puerto Rico with San Juan, St. John, St. Thomas, St. Martin or St. Maarten and the British and American Virgin Islands. Peak season for the cruise is from December to April but cheaper rates are usually during the summer. The months of June to November are not conducive to sailing as they are hurricane and typhoon season.

Exotic Southern Caribbean Cruises

Experience a cruise which offers a sight beyond the ordinary and jump in to a new adventure in a southern Caribbean cruise. You see diverse and amazing sights in the southern part of this region. You get the chance to see a myriad of cultures and pristine natural sites that are totally matchless. Other than the amazing beaches of Aruba, it is also worth seeing the combination of Spanish and Indian culture. The islands of Guadeloupe and Martinique with their Creole and French influence, offers the volcanic sights as well as a peek at their lush floral gardens and verdant rain forests. The previously Dutch ruled island of Curacao with adorable and colorful architecture still standing and boasting Mother Natures gift of favorable trade winds. French living continues to exist in St. Barth made obvious by the stylish sights at the beach, luxurious shopping extravaganza, and sumptuously opulent dining. Room Choices in Caribbean Cruises

Going on a Caribbean cruise is equally made perfect by staying in the best accommodation type or cabin of your choice. Get to decide which ship you are taking as cabins and rooms are different with every cruise line and their specific vessels. Staterooms or standard rooms are the most economical and smallest of all with only the essential furnishings available and no window most of the time. For those wanting a glimpse of how the Caribbean Sea and neighboring islands look from their room, then Ocean view rooms are the best alternatives having a window or porthole in addition to larger dimensions. There are also cabins with balconies or verandas from where you can clearly see the ocean and relish the stream of fresh sea air. For a more luxurious and classy cruise, the suite accommodation is perfect with the fully furnished cabin and lavishly decorated interiors plus a large bathroom.
